Newton Heath Class 108 dmu N612 sits in one of the bay platforms at Lancaster in 1988 waiting to head for Morecambe. Nearest the camera is DTSL M54266 based at Newton heath throughout the 1980s. Its partner is presumbaly 53983. Tony Walmsley.
Class 108 Derby 2-car DMU set T208, presumably 54266 + 53983 (DTCL + DMBS), reverses out of platform 1 as part of a move to platform 2 at Stratford upon Avon on 15 March 1989. On Tour With The Class 13 Army.
Class 108 dmu comprising 53983 and 54266 (closest), seen at Skegness in April 1991. Robert28194.
Class 108 DTC M54266 at Snailwell on 18th August 1991. It had been withdrawn on the 29th July. Nicholas Youngman.
A (blue square) Derby Lightweight DMU at Grange-over-Sands on 19 August 1967. The vehicles - M56267 and M50984 - were allocated to Accrington at the time. Carrying Bristol set number B973, this is presumably 54267 + 53629 which were transferred to Cardiff about this time. They sit in platform 6 at Crewe station, having worked up from Hereford with the first service of the day. I had worked it up from Hereford and would work it back all stations to Shrewsbury, where I would stable it in Abbey Foregate sidings. The photo was taken sometime between 2nd and 7th May 1988 as I worked the turn for the week. Paul James.
Departing from Newport on 20 February 1989 is two-car Class 108 DMU set C973 (54267 and presumably 53629) working the 13:55 Cardiff Central - Chepstow service. Robert Thomas.
C973 (54267 + 53629) at Cardiff Central 23 March 1990 being passed by 37 702. Sparegang.
The 11:15 to Chepstow departs from Cardiff Central on 15 December 1990. It is formed of two-car Class 108 DMU set C973 containing 54267 and presumably 53629. Robert Thomas.
A Class 108 at Manchester Victoria on April 25, 1992, 54267 closest. John Carter.
With Leicester on the destination blind a (blue square) Derby Lightweight twin is seen in Birmingham New Street station in January 1961. Closest seems to be M56268 which was allocated to Toton at the time. Michael Mensing.
A (blue square) Derby Lightweight DMU seen at the site of Speke station in mid-September 1961. Michael Mensing.
Class 108 M56268 at Pwllheli on 15 July 1974. Sunday was the day of rest on the Cambrian Coast and that's exactly what this Derby unit was doing that afternoon. Alistair Ness.
Derby twin 56268 & 50985 derailed on the branch crossover at Helsby, whilst swapping from P4 to P3 to work the Rock Ferry service, 23/6/77. Anthony Griffiths.
At 8.28pm towards the end of a fine Summer evening with the sun setting in the West, an eight-car DMU forming a Carlisle to Preston 'Dalesrail' service was stood at Bamber Bridge on August 7th 1988. With the rear of the train standing on the level crossing, the driver was looking back along the train. The formation was M54268 & M53934, M53334 & M51206, M53492 & M53439, M53948 & M53944. Martyn Hilbert.
Class 108 DMU set B963 (presumably 54268 + 53948) departs from Chippenham on 4th August 1989. Nicholas T Smith.
Recently repainted Class 108 DTCL M56269 on Chester Depot on 22 September 1979. On the right is Class 120 vehicle M50695. Brian Daniels.
A picturesque scene as Class 108 2-car DMU 54269 + 53929 (DTCL + DMBS) approaches Mouldsworth Junction with a Chester-Manchester service on 1-6-88. On Tour With The Class 13 Army.
A Class 108 2-car DMU (54269 + 53929) crossing Mouldsworth Junction with a Chester - Manchester service on 1-6-88. On Tour With the Class 13 Army.
A two-car Class 108 (CH270, 54259 and presumably 53929) and a two-car Class 101 in Barrow station, circa 1988 / 1989. Stuart Mackay Collection.
